Position Summary: We are seeking a Production Coordinator to optimize operations in metal structure workshops, ensuring quality, safety, and continuous improvement. Key Highlights: 1. Coordination and optimization of production operations in workshops. 2. Leadership in continuous improvement, process standardization, and efficiency. 3. Focus on quality, safety, and productivity in metal manufacturing. **Academic Qualifications:** Industrial, Mechanical, or Mechatronics Engineering, or related field. **Experience:** * Minimum 2 years coordinating or supervising production in metal structure workshops or industrial manufacturing. * Demonstrable experience in improving and standardizing production processes. * Knowledge of blueprint interpretation, welding specifications, and quality control for metal structures. **Position Objective** * Coordinate and optimize workshop production operations, ensuring adherence to manufacturing schedules, quality and safety standards, promoting continuous improvement and process standardization to increase efficiency, reduce waste, and enhance personnel and equipment productivity. **Main Responsibilities** * Plan, coordinate, and monitor the production schedule according to customer requirements and established deadlines. * Analyze fabrication, assembly, welding, cutting, and painting processes to identify improvement opportunities and propose technical and operational solutions. * Supervise compliance with quality standards within the workshop. * Coordinate with engineering, quality, and logistics departments to ensure efficient material and information flow. * Monitor key production performance indicators (KPIs): efficiency, downtime, rework, schedule adherence, among others. * Implement continuous improvement tools (5S, Lean Manufacturing, Kaizen, process standardization). * Train operational staff on new procedures, best practices, and efficient manufacturing techniques. * Ensure preventive maintenance of workshop machinery and tools. * Participate in production planning and control meetings, presenting progress and deviations. **Technical Knowledge:** * Metal manufacturing processes: cutting, assembly, welding, painting, and installation. * Production control and capacity planning. * Continuous improvement methodologies (Lean Manufacturing, 5S, Kaizen, SMED). * Performance indicators (KPIs) and efficiency analysis. * Applicable standards for metal structures (AWS D1\.1, ASTM, AISC, etc.). **Soft Skills:** * Results-oriented leadership. * Analytical thinking and focus on continuous improvement. * Effective communication and collaborative teamwork. * Planning and organization. * Ability to manage change and standardize processes.
